of/irq: add missing of_node_put

for_each_matching_node performs an of_node_get on each iteration, so
a break out of the loop requires an of_node_put.

A simplified version of the semantic patch that fixes this problem is as
follows (http://coccinelle.lip6.fr):

// <smpl>
@@
local idexpression n;
expression e;
identifier l;
@@

 for_each_matching_node(n,...) {
   ...
(
   of_node_put(n);
|
   e = n
|
+  of_node_put(n);
?  goto l;
)
   ...
 }
...
l: ... when != n
// </smpl>

Besides the issue found by the semantic patch, this code also stores the
device_node value in a list, which requires an of_node_get, and then cleans
up the list on exit from the function, which requires an of_node_put.
